oracle
1. an authoritative person who divines the future • Syn: prophet, prophesier, seer, vaticinator • Derivationally related forms: vaticinate (for: vaticinator), oracular, prophetic (for: prophet) • Hypernyms: diviner • Hyponyms: augur, auspex, prophetess, sibyl 2. a prophecy (usually obscure or allegorical) revealed by a priest or priestess; believed to be infallible • Derivationally related forms: oracular • Hypernyms: prophecy, divination 3. a shrine where an oracular god is consulted • Hypernyms: shrine • Instance Hyponyms: Temple of Apollo, Oracle of Apollo, Delphic oracle, oracle of Delphi
